Antonino Tamburello

Neuropsychiatrist and Cognitive-Behavioral Psychotherapist

With over 50 years of experience in Clinical Psychology and Cognitive-Behavioral Psychotherapy, he is a reference figure at national and international level. Founder of leading academic and scientific institutions, he has dedicated his career to research, teaching and clinic. His innovative methodology, known as Cognitive Causal Therapy, represents an evolution in the field of modern psychotherapy.
Founder of the Skinner Institute in Rome (1973) and Naples (1999): Centers of Excellence for Training and Clinical Therapy in Cognitive-Behavioral Psychotherapy and of the Degree Course in Psychology at the European University of Rome, he held the position of Coordinator and Extraordinary Professor of Clinical and Community Psychology (2005-2014).
He is the author of Causal Cognitive Therapy: An innovative model that integrates the cognitive approach with an investigative investigation based on deductive logic and the search for the root causes of psychological suffering. He was a guest of the Liberevento Cultural Festival in 2025 with the book “L’amore nasce eterno” (Ed. Mondadori).
